Block walls serve both functional and aesthetic purposes in landscaping, providing structure, personal privacy, and visual interest to outside areas. These walls can be used to maintain soil on sloped residential or commercial properties, define garden beds, or develop clear limits within a landscape. The choice of block type-- concrete, interlocking, or ornamental-- impacts both the strength and look of the wall. Appropriate preparation makes sure stability, especially for taller walls, with factors to consider for drainage, support, and soil pressure. Installation starts with a well-prepared base, frequently involving excavation and leveling to ensure the wall stays straight and steady with time. Mortar or adhesive may be used depending on the block type, and reinforcement like rebar can improve sturdiness. A experienced landscaper ensures each course is level and aligned, avoiding future moving or cracking. Block walls likewise provide creative opportunities through finishes, textures, and colors, enabling them to complement the surrounding landscape. Incorporating lighting, planters, or cascading plants can soften the hard edges, making the wall both useful and aesthetically enticing. Routine examinations and small repair work help keep the wall's stability for many years to come
